"Your the Grandfather of What?"

by Ron Glowczynski

Over the years, I developed a friendship, though unusual, with none other than, Dick Howard, fellow RCO member and the Grandfather of Mountain Biking in the RoVa. One day, after discussing his meeting with President Bush, I asked him, “Dick ole’ buddy, you are, of course, the Grandfather of Mountain Biking in the RoVa, but who is the Grandfather of Road Biking in the RoVa”?

My first thought would be the athletic legend Artie Levin, but Dick said, “Nope”. He informed me that Artie started cycling in 1972 and Dick started seven years earlier. Dick then said, "Well, I guess it's me! I am the Grandfather of Mountain AND Road Biking in the RoVa"!

This was just too much. Though my friend, Dick is obnoxious enough as the mountain biking grandfather and also as the Godfather of Homemade Sauerkraut, but to hold the road bike crown? Well, we can't let him be the road grandfather, too; unless he is that deserving! Besides, Dick said that the dual responsibility would be too much of a burdensome honor for anyone of his abundant modesty to bear.

So I am proposing a contest to select someone to be the "Grandfather or Grandmother of Road Biking in the RoVa". 

Here are the rules:

1.  Describe in at least 25 words, but no more than 200 words: Why do you deserve to be the Grandfather or Grandmother of Road Biking in the RoVa?
2.  Must provide two references, not related to you, in order to validate your claim. Include their name, address, phone numbers, email, how long you’ve known them, and shoe size.
3.  Your road biking existence must pre-date Dick Howard’s claim of 1965.
4.  Submit a photo which will be used for the winner and runner-ups or other promotional needs.
5.  And last, you must have an established continuous presence as a road biker in the RoVa (RoVa is Roanoke Virginia if you haven’t caught that yet). You are allowed up to two years of lapse time from your Roanoke presence, but you must be currently present.

 

The decision will be posted on the RCO webpage and on the list serve. All decisions by the judge are final and may be arbitrary and/or based on petty personality differences, cat fights, gossip, innuendo, jealousies or personal hygiene.

The winner will receive the honor to use the Grandfather or Grandmother of Road Biking of RoVa for eternity and a meal at Dick Howard’s favorite restaurant, Mac & Bob’s in the SaVa.

The King of SHT Makes Contact

submitted by Ron Glowczynski

Patrick O’Grady, who is cartoonist (VeloNews) and writer for various cycling publications, started the whole SHT deal with his published stories (look below).  RCO Race Director and website guru, Ron Glowczynski sent the story on the "SHT Dumper"back in 2002, which received a response from the Mad Dog - here is his response:

"Hey, Ron,

Just popped by the site to see what kind of SHT you guys were trying to pull ... very funny stuff.  I wish I'd thought of it myself.  I especially like the racing shot; that's a real howler.

The scary thing is, you just know a group of wealthy masters is gonna start racing the real SHT once they lay their flabby little hands on it, and then USAC is gonna have to print up another hundred or so stars-and-stripes jerseys for the various age-graded categories. Still, the new sponsors SHT-racing brings in -- Delco, EverReady, Ray-O-Vac and a veritable flood of personal-injury attorneys eager to cash in on the latest in assault by battery -- might just cover the costs. Hell, I might find another market for my ravings once Battery Retailer & Industry News makes its debut.  Plus an off-road version can't be far off, so we can expect to see the damn' things in mountain cross and downhill. Because, as you know, SHT rolls downhill."

Cheers,

Patrick O'Grady
